CC493K Bronze vs. C87500 Brass

Both CC493K bronze and C87500 brass are copper alloys. Both are furnished in the as-fabricated (no temper or treatment) condition. They have 86%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(1,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is CC493K bronze and the bottom bar is C87500 brass.
